CVE-2022-50639

CVE-2022-50639 describes a Linux kernel issue where, during io-wq worker creation, a CPU mask allocation failure could leak memory from the io_wqe structure if not yet added to the wqes array. CVE-2025-39895

CVE-2025-39895: Linux kernel sched_numa_find_nth_cpu() could dereference a null pointer when the CPU mask used by sched_domains_numa_masks does not intersect with the cpus offline.
